• Deaf Leaders Foundation

UK declares China's treatment of Uighur Muslims as 'genocide'

UK lawmakers have voted to declare China's treatment of its Uighur minority population in the Xinjiang region a "genocide". The motion passed is non-binding and doesn't compel British government to act. China has been accused of detaining up to one million people in camps in Xinjiang in recent years, with survivors alleging widespread abuse, including torture, rape and forced labor.

0 views0 comments